Course schedule

1
Preparing and organizing your prospecting

  • Take stock of your current portfolio: ABC matrix.
  • Identify geographical sectors and types of company to prospect.
  • Design effective prospecting scenarios.
  • Define and select tools.
Exercise
Diagnosis using the SWOT matrix. Draw up a prospecting plan and plan actions.

2
Develop communications adapted to prospecting

  • Master interpersonal communication techniques.
  • Practice rapid communication: the elevator pitch.
  • Adopt positive communication and appropriate language.
  • Pratiquer l'écoute active.
  • Identify the prospect's potential motivational levers.
  • Adapt your communication to the context: telephone, face-to-face.
Role-playing
Generate interest over the phone and face-to-face.

3
Prospecting via the Internet: social selling

  • An overview of digital prospecting tools.
  • Understand the impact of social selling, define a strategy.
  • Build your professional identity.
  • Discover the methods and practices of social auditing.
Exercise
Successful contact. Define your unique customer profile. Build a "buyer persona". Present your objectives.returnchariot

4
Overcoming the obstacle of the dam

  • Overcoming the telephone and LinkedIn roadblock: tips and best practices.
  • Get recommended on professional social networks.
Role-playing
Overcoming obstacles. Collective debriefing.

5
Using objections

  • Understand the performance argument mechanism.
  • Prepare responses to objections.
  • Use the objection as an opportunity.
  • Relax the presentation of the prize.
Role-playing
Handle customer objections while maintaining the relationship.

6
Manage your prospecting schedule

  • Organize and "time" your telephone and online prospecting.
  • Create a prospecting rhythm using digital tools.
  • Master your prospecting action plan.
Exercise
Organize your prospecting agenda according to the mission profile.
